Ingredients

  • 1 (14 oz) can of artichoke hearts, drained and chopped
  • 1 (15 oz) can of chickpeas, drained and rinsed
  • 1/2 cup rolled oats (gluten-free if needed)
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ons ground flaxseed mixed with 6 tablespoons water (flax egg)
  • 2 tablespoons nutritional yeast
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ce or tamari for gluten-free
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or avocado oil, for cooking

Equipment

  • Large mixing bowl
  • Food processor or blender
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Frying pan or non-stick skillet
  • Spatula
  • Baking sheet (optional for oven-baking)
  • Parchment paper (optional)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the flax egg: In a small bowl, combine the ground flaxseed with water and stir well. Let it sit for 5-10 minutes until it thickens.
  2. Process the base ingredients: In a food processor, add the drained artichoke hearts, chickpeas, rolled oats, chopped onion, garlic, and parsley. Pulse until the mixture is finely chopped but still has some texture. Avoid over-processing to keep some bite in the patties.
  3. Combine the mixture: Transfer the processed mixture to a large bowl. Add the flax egg, nutritional yeast, soy sauce, smoked paprika, cumin, salt, and pepper.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are well incorporated.
  4. Form the patties: Using your hands, shape the mixture into 4-6 equal-sized patties, about 3/4 inch thick. If the mixture feels too wet, add a tablespoon of oats at a time until it holds together well.
  5. Cook the burgers: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Cook the patties for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crispy on the outside. For a healthier option, you can bake them in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through.
  6. Serve and enjoy: Place the cooked patties on your favorite burger buns, add your preferred toppings, and enjoy!

Tips & Variations

For a gluten-free version, be sure to use gluten-free oats and tamari instead of soy sauce.

Feel free to experiment with different herbs and spices. Adding fresh basil or cilantro can give the burgers a fresh twist, while a pinch of chili powder or cayenne pepper will add a little heat.

If you want a cheesier flavor, increase the nutritional yeast to 3 tablespoons.

To make these patties more filling, mix in some finely chopped mushrooms or shredded carrots. They add moisture and nutrients without overwhelming the artichoke flavor.

If you prefer a firmer burger, chilling the patties in the fridge for at least 30 minutes before cooking helps them hold their shape better. You can also freeze the uncooked patties for up to a month; just thaw before cooking.

Serving Suggestions

These artichoke burgers are incredibly versatile when it comes to serving. For a classic burger experience, stack them on a toasted bun with fresh lettuce, tomato slices, red onion rings, and your favorite vegan mayo or mustard.

Adding avocado or guacamole gives a creamy contrast that pairs beautifully with the artichoke’s subtle flavor.

For a lighter option, serve the patties on a bed of mixed greens or inside a whole wheat pita with a drizzle of tahini sauce. You could also explore Mediterranean vibes by topping the burger with vegan tzatziki, cucumbers, and olives.
